(KNSI) — The Minnesota State Fair has 65 brand new beverages for the 2023 Great Minnesota Get Together, three of which are from a central Minnesota brewery.
Lupulin Brewing out of Big Lake has dreamed up three new beverages this year.
The first is the Beergarita Ale. It is an ale “infused with tangy lime and citrus flavors to mimic the classic drink.” They say it’s a “great refreshment for warm weather.”
The Beergarita Ale can be found at Coasters on the southeast corner of Carnes Avenue and Liggett Street.
Next up is the Vacation Mullet. It is described as a tropical hazy IPA with a “smooth, beach-ready body” with coconut, pineapple, and mandarin orange notes.
Vacation Mullet is pouring at the Ball Park Café located on the east side of Underwood Street between Dan Patch and Carnes avenues, outside The Garden.
Last but not least is the Cherry Limeade. It’s a blonde ale with cherry flavor melding with tart, aromatic lime peel and purée.
You will find this mouth watering refresher at The Hangar on the northeast corner of Underwood Street and Murphy Avenue.
The Minnesota State Fair runs from August 24th through Labor Day.
